Google Mobilegeddon: Don’t Panic, Here’s What You Need to Know

B2B Marketing Traction

Google changed their search engine algorithm to favor mobile friendly websites. Google announced this algorithm change early – a few months ago – letting website owners know that they would begin to favor mobile friendly websites in the search results starting on April 21. Does Your Website Have Performance Issues?

B2B Marketing Traction

Your website is often the first impression prospective customers have of your company and brand. How well your website works also affects search engine performance. In Google’s recent algorithm changes, how quickly your website loads makes a difference, as does the depth of your webpage structure.
